FORCE 12/15/17 CARBY COMPLETE # FP-CM1213-1

FORCE 12/15/17 CARBY COMPLETE # FP-CM1213-1

Regular price $70.62 Sale

FORCE 12/15/17 CARBY COMPLETE # FP-CM1213-1